‘Regenerate’: COVID-19 gives hospitality a chance to focus on sustainability


The COVID-19 crisis holds opportunities if seen through the lens of sustainability, said Middle East hospitality veterans at the recent Arabian Hotel Investment Conference.

“It’s not just about lowering impact and being less bad. But we need to regenerate,” said Eric Ricaurte, the founder and CEO of Greenview, a hospitality-centric sustainability consultancy.  

The expert sees a shift in focus by including a hotel’s life cycle on the sustainability agenda. Deviating from just the operational side pushes the conversation from the profit and loss statement to the balance sheet.
